Job DescriptionThe Regulatory & Contract Compliance Manager serves as the central guardian of compliance across ITMC and 101VOICE, ensuring all operations align with federal, state, and local telecom regulations. This individual manages the company’s regulatory filings, telecom taxation, and contractual obligations while maintaining strong relationships with key agencies such as the FCC, CPUC, and public-sector procurement bodies.
This position also plays a critical cross-functional role in contract management, HR compliance, and account governance, bridging the legal, financial, and operational teams. The ideal candidate is highly detail-oriented, proactive, and comfortable working in a dynamic environment that demands precision, accountability, and consistent follow-through.
Key Responsibilities
Regulatory & Tax Compliance
Prepare and submit all required FCC and CPUC filings, including Form 499Q, 499A, and 477.
Coordinate Access Line Reporting for CPUC and TUFF and ensure regulatory fee accuracy.
Oversee relationships with third-party compliance and tax partners, including escrow management and fee remittances.
Monitor regulatory law updates related to UCaaS, VoIP, and telecom services, and translate them into internal policies or customer communications.
Produce detailed monthly and quarterly telecom tax and regulatory fee reports using billing system data.
Develop pivot tables and analytical summaries for tax classification, fee trending, and variance reporting.
Collaborate with accounting, executive, and CPA teams to ensure synchronized reporting and financial accuracy.
File reports with GSA, CMAS, TIPS, and other Joint Powers Authority (JPA) organizations as required.
Contract Management & Compliance
Review and interpret customer, vendor, and partner contracts to ensure compliance, clarity, and protection of company interests.
Draft and revise Sales Agent and Partner Agreements, addenda, and related attachments.
Participate in customer and partner meetings for government and education sector contracts (e.g., GSA, TIPS, NASPO, OMNIA, CMAS, SPURR, MICTA).
Coordinate with insurance providers to verify and meet insurance and indemnity requirements.
Assess bond requirements (bid, performance, payment) and obtain appropriate documentation from bond agencies.
Maintain a centralized contract repository and track key renewal and amendment milestones.
Recommend risk mitigation strategies and propose improvements to standard contract templates.
HR & Organizational Compliance
Manage employee records and compliance within Gusto (payroll, benefits, I-9, and time-off).
Update and distribute Employee Handbooks, internal policies, and compliance notices.
Communicate and implement changes related to labor, payroll, or benefits regulations.
Oversee updates to online Terms of Service, Privacy Policies, and compliance statements.
Support periodic internal audits to ensure HR and contract compliance integrity.
